Abstract

The utility model provides a kind of multi-functional voice coil bobbin winder device, including pedestal, it further include wire spool, traveller, driving assembly and rotary components, the top of pedestal is equipped with a sliding rail, the sliding dress of traveller is on the slide rail, wire spool is sleeved on traveller, and it can be rotated around the glide direction of sliding rail, wire spool is equipped with voice coil conducting wire, driving assembly includes driving motor and screw rod, driving motor is fixed at the top of the base, screw rod is arranged along the glide direction of sliding rail, and one end of screw rod is fixedly connected with the output shaft of driving motor, the other end is threadedly coupled through traveller and with traveller, rotary components include rotating electric machine and the socket column being sleeved on the motor shaft of rotating electric machine, rotating electric machine is arranged in the top of pedestal along the glide direction of sliding rail, and it is located at the side of wire spool.Bobbin winder device in the utility model realizes and carries out coiling to voice coil automatically, improves the efficiency of voice coil coiling, time saving and energy saving, reduces cost of labor.

Background technique
Voice coil is the important component of dynamic speaker vibrational system, it may also be said to be the heart of loudspeaker.Voice coil Performance will affect sound pressure frequency characteristic, sound pressure level, impedance curve, distortion, transient response, loudspeaker parameters, the sound of loudspeaker The receiving power of the parameters such as matter, especially relationship loudspeaker and service life.
The coil that voice coil generally includes the skeleton in cylindrical toroidal and is set around on skeleton, therefore in the process of voice coil production In the middle, coiling is an important procedure.
In the prior art, for current voice coil winding process usually by being accomplished manually, low efficiency is time-consuming and laborious, and artificial It is at high cost.

Referring to Fig. 1, showing the bobbin winder device in the utility model first embodiment, including pedestal 10, traveller 20, wire spool 30, driving assembly 40 and rotary components 50.
The top of the pedestal 10 is equipped with a sliding rail 11, and the sliding rail 11 is in T-shaped.The traveller 20 is sliding mounted in described On sliding rail 11.
Wherein, the traveller 20 includes interconnecting piece 21, socket part 22 and annular against platform 23.The interconnecting piece 21 is vertical Sliding to be mounted on the sliding rail 11, the socket part 22 is vertically connected on the end of the interconnecting piece 21, and along the sliding rail 11 Glide direction arrangement.The junction for being located at the interconnecting piece 21 and the socket part 22 against platform 23.
The wire spool 30 is sleeved on the socket part 22, and is resisted against described on platform 23, while the coiling Disk 30 can be rotated around the glide direction of the sliding rail 11, and the wire spool 30 is equipped with voice coil conducting wire A.
The driving component 40 includes driving motor 41 and screw rod 42, and the driving motor 41 is fixed on the pedestal 10 Top, the screw rod 42 is arranged along the glide direction of the sliding rail 11, and one end of the screw rod 42 and the driving motor 41 Output shaft be fixedly connected, the other end of the screw rod 42 is threadedly coupled through the interconnecting piece 21 and with the interconnecting piece 21, To constitute ball screw arrangement.
The rotary components 50 include rotating electric machine 51 and the socket column being sleeved on the motor shaft of the rotating electric machine 51 52, the rotating electric machine 51 is arranged in the top of the pedestal 10 along the glide direction of the sliding rail 11, and is located at the coiling The side of disk 30, the socket column 52 is for being socketed speech coil framework.
Preferably, set on the outer wall of the socket column 52 there are two magnet 521, the magnet 521 in a ring, and two institutes It states the inclination of magnet 521 and what is intersected is looped around on the outer wall of the socket column 52.
It should be pointed out that since the socket column 52 has inlayed the magnet 521, and the speech coil framework is by metal Material is fabricated, and when the speech coil framework set is attached on the socket column 52, the magnet 521 will adsorb the voice coil bone Frame, to reinforce the speech coil framework.Further, since two magnet 521 that the socket column 52 is inlayed tilt and intersect row Cloth increases the covering adsorption plane of magnet, it is ensured that adsorption capacity suffered by the speech coil framework is uniform, and will not rotate skidding Phenomenon.
It should be understood that in order to achieve the purpose that further to reinforce the speech coil framework, it is described in other embodiments The magnet quantity that socket column 52 is inlayed can also be one or more.
Referring to Fig. 2, the perspective view under the bobbin winder device showing in the present embodiment is in running order, when needs pair When voice coil carries out coiling, speech coil framework B can be covered and be connected on socket column 52, and by the voice coil conducting wire A pre-wound one on wire spool 30 Then circle starts rotating electric machine 51 on speech coil framework B, to drive socket column 52 to rotate, and then drive speech coil framework B rotation, Voice coil conducting wire A will be constantly wound on speech coil framework, carry out coiling to voice coil automatically to realize.Simultaneously, to voice coil into When row coiling, driving motor 41 can be started to drive screw rod 42 to rotate, under the action of ball-screw principle, traveller 20 is by direction Driving motor 41 is mobile, and wire spool 30 will follow traveller 20 to slide together at this time, so that voice coil conducting wire A is wound into speech coil framework On position also follow movement, with around completely entire speech coil framework, meanwhile, in mobile process, by described against platform 23 Limitation, the voice coil conducting wire A wound on the wire spool 30 will not off-lines, it is ensured that normal coiling.
To sum up, the bobbin winder device in the utility model above-described embodiment realizes and carries out coiling to voice coil automatically, improves The efficiency of voice coil coiling, it is time saving and energy saving, reduce cost of labor.Moreover, ball screw arrangement is constituted by setting Driving assembly it is synchronous with movement to realize coiling, it is ensured that voice coil conducting wire can eliminate artificial tune around completely entire speech coil framework The process of line position further improves the efficiency of voice coil coiling.
Fig. 3 to Fig. 4 is please referred to, the bobbin winder device that the utility model second embodiment is worked as, the coiling in the present embodiment are shown Device and the bobbin winder device in first embodiment are more or less the same, the difference is that, bobbin winder device in the present embodiment into One step includes a gland 60, and no longer embedded magnet on the socket column 52.
The bottom of the gland 60 is equipped with a screw 61, and the top of the gland 60 is installed with hexagonal (hexagon)nut 62.The set The distal end faces for connecing column 52 are equipped with a threaded hole 522 to match with the screw 61.
It should be understood that when the speech coil framework set is attached on the socket column 52, using the dress of screw and screw hole With mode, the gland 60 is encased in the distal end faces of the socket column 52, to squeeze the speech coil framework (such as Fig. 4 institute Show), have reached the purpose for reinforcing the speech coil framework, it is ensured that the motor shaft of the speech coil framework and the rotating electric machine 51 can be same Step rotation.
Further, the bottom of the gland 60 is equipped with rubber pad 63, and the rubber pad 63 can be capable of increasing and institute The frictional force for stating speech coil framework further prevents the speech coil framework to skid, on the other hand can also prevent from damaging the voice coil by pressure Skeleton.
